Matt Rutherford, the first person ever to sail solo and nonstop around the Americas, recounts the first Ocean Research Project expedition to the North Atlantic Gyre and the inspiration and hard work that got him there in the first place (don't miss Episode 2, released earlier today, when Matt describes the dramatic salvage attempt on the Swan 48 Wolfhound during this trip). Otherwise known as the 'Atlantic Garbage Patch' - the Pacific's ugly cousin - Rutherford and NOAA scientist Nicole Trenholm sailed nearly 7,000 miles to gather and bring back home samples he hopes will help solve at least a little bit of our ocean's problems. The couple spent 80 days at sea, including a short stop in Bermuda for repairs and refueling. This is the story.
